Divljana Monastery

Divljana Monastery, also known as Monastery of St. Demetrius is an orthodox monastery which belongs to the Eparchy of Niš, part of the Serbian Orthodox Eparchy. The monastery is located near the village of Divljana and Divljana Lake,〔(South-east Serbia: Monastery of St. Demetrius and record ), Language: Serbian, accessed 17. 2. 2013.〕 5 km south of Bela Palanka, in the foothills of Suva Planina, 450 m above sea level.〔(Srpska.ru: Monastey of St. Demetrius, 28. 7. 2006. ), Language: Serbian, accessed 17. 2. 2013.〕 It is dedicated to St. Demetrius,〔(The municipality of Bela Palanka: Monastery of St. Demetrius ), Language: Serbian,accessed 17. 2. 2013.〕 who is celebrated on 8 November.〔(Pravoslavlje no. 927: Restoration of the Divljana Monastery, M. Radenković ), Language: Serbian, accessed 17. 2. 2013.〕 The orthodox monastery was first built in 394 at this location which later became the property of the Mrnjavčević brothers at the end of the 13th century, after the destruction of the monastery.〔 In the monastery complex, there are records of ancient burials from the 4th century, some of which can be seen two of the capitals. Around 880, with the revival of Christianization, there were also new eparchies.〔 Based on physical evidence and the Charter of the Byzantine emperor Basil II, archaeologists believe that the site also included an early Christian building from the 9th century〔 related to a renewal of church life in Middle Ponišavlje.〔
==Location and characteristics of the monastery complex==
The Monastery of St. Demetrius in Divljana belongs to the Eparchy of Niš and to administrative municipality of Bela Palanka. It is located 5 km south of Bela Palanka, not far from the ancient road to Skopje and Thessaloniki. Situated 450 meters above sea level in the foothills of the south-eastern part of Suva Planina, with wooded slopes around the monastery, offering a unique view of the Svrljig Mountains and the summit of Šljivovica.
